Q3 Planning Note — Board of Directors

Veltrane Systems will raise legacy-tier pricing by 12% effective the start of Q4, affecting roughly 340 accounts still on the Corvid platform. Churn modeling by the Marlow office projects losses under 4%, offset by margin gains within two quarters. Notification letters go out in six weeks. The broader strategic rationale is summarized in the confidential note below.

board note of bawep-tajef: Queniusek Systems plans to raise the Quenvan list price by 53.1 percent in March. The pricing group signed off on a budget of $176.4 million for Project Drueth. The renewal with Casionix Partners closes at $142.5 million a year, 8.3 percent below the last contract. Project Fraax slips by six weeks because of the tooling delay.

## Artifact Signing — Tidemark Widget

Support: customers sometimes report the Tidemark tide-table widget failing to load after an update. Usual cause: stale cached bundle failing signature verification. Have them clear the widget cache and re-fetch. All Tidemark bundles are signed at build time by the Saltgrass release pipeline; unsigned or tampered bundles are rejected client-side. Do not advise users to disable verification. To confirm a bundle was signed by us, check it against the following key.

rollout seal: bky3_Zik

**Mgmt Meeting Minutes — Retiring the Brightline Range**

Quick recap for sales leads at Fenholt Supplies: we agreed to retire the Brightline fixture range by year-end. Remaining stock moves to clearance pricing next month, and accounts on standing orders get migrated to the Lumetta range. Trade-in incentives were approved in principle. The confidential note on next steps sits just below.

board note of bajof-bajeg: The pricing group signed off on a budget of $13.4 million for Project Sildor. The renewal with Lamixek Holdings closes at $48.9 million a year, 49 percent above the last contract.

## Further Reading

If you are building plugins for Gridloom, our crossword generator, we strongly recommend studying the fill-engine internals before writing custom clue providers or grid validators. The plugin API is stable, but ordering guarantees during backtracking are subtle and frequently misunderstood. A complete walkthrough of the solver lifecycle, hook points, and versioning policy is maintained on the page below.

operations page: https://confluence.qorvellabs.internal/pages/projects/projects/projects